    What to Look for in an AC Repair Service for Retail

    The right repair firm should prioritize rapid response, expertise with commercial HVAC systems, transparent pricing, and proven reliability. Retail environments require providers who understand the critical times—busy weekends, peak shopping hours—and can deliver timely fixes without sacrificing quality.

    Best for

    • Emergency repairs during busy hours
    • Preventive maintenance plans for retail chains
    • Systems with complex or older HVAC units

    Key Specs

    • Response Time: Under 2 hours for urgent calls
    • Experience: Minimum 5 years with commercial systems
    • Certifications: Industry-standard credentials like HVCA or NICEIC
    • Services: Installation, repairs, routine maintenance, and emergency callouts

    Tradeoffs

    • Cost vs. Speed: Faster response may come at a premium; balance with budget constraints
    • Specialist vs. Generalist: Tiered services may prioritize general HVAC fixes over retail-specific needs
    • Availability: Larger firms may guarantee rapid response but less personalized service

    How to Choose the Right Repair Firm

    **1. Assess Your System’s Complexity:** Retail stores often operate with sophisticated multi-zone systems. Ensure the firm has experience with your specific setup.

    **2. Prioritize Response Times:** In retail, waiting days isn’t an option. Ask about their average emergency response times.

    **3. Check Credibility and References:** Look for reviews, testimonials, and industry certifications. A proven track record in retail repair is invaluable.

    **4. Confirm Preventive Offerings:** Routine maintenance can prevent costly breakdowns. Choose firms offering tailored service contracts.

    **5. Clarify Pricing Structure:** Transparent quotes and clear billing practices help avoid surprises during emergencies.

    **6. Evaluate Accessibility:** Local firms with a dedicated 24/7 hotline ensure quick communication for urgent issues.

    Practical Recommendations for Retailers

    – **Build Relationships with Reliable Firms:** Establish contacts before emergencies occur. Regular maintenance keeps systems resilient.
    – **Keep Emergency Contacts Handy:** Have a list of approved repair firms accessible to managers and staff.
    – **Invest in Preventive Maintenance:** Well-maintained systems last longer and require less emergency repair, saving costs in the long run.
    – **Document System Details:** Maintain records of model numbers, past repairs, and service history—all useful for technicians during urgent fixes.

    Invisalign vs Implant Marketing: A Practical Comparison for UK Dental Practices

    When considering marketing strategies for dental practices aiming to boost visibility and patient inquiries, understanding the nuances between Invisalign and implant marketing services is crucial. For a detailed breakdown, refer to the Invisalign marketing vs implant marketing services comparison. This comparison helps practices identify which approach offers the best ROI based on their specific service focus and target demographic.

    Best for

    Invisalign Marketing

    Best suited for practices targeting younger demographics or those emphasizing cosmetic dental solutions. Invisalign marketing is effective when promoting clear aligner therapies to patients seeking discreet orthodontic options.

    Implant Marketing

    Ideal for practices with a broader adult demographic, especially those focusing on restorative dentistry, tooth replacement, and complex cases. Implant marketing services reach patients needing durable, long-term solutions.

    Key Specs

    • Invisalign Marketing: Emphasizes visual campaigns showcasing smile transformations, utilizing before-after imagery, case studies, and patient testimonials. Platforms include social media, SEO-optimized content, and targeted ads.
    • Implant Marketing: Focuses on educational content, emphasizing the durability, success rates, and long-term benefits of implants. Uses detailed case studies, videos, and articles to persuade potential patients.

    Tradeoffs

    • Invisalign: Typically requires more frequent updates and engaging visual content to attract younger, aesthetic-conscious patients. The competition is higher, which may lead to higher ad spend.
    • Implant: Often involves more complex sales funnels. The decision process is longer; patients need more information and reassurance, which demands comprehensive content and follow-up strategies. ROI can be slower but often yields higher-value cases.

    How to Choose

    Assess your practice’s strengths, patient demographics, and the services most in demand. If your practice already has a steady stream of aesthetic patients and you want to boost Invisalign cases, specialized social media campaigns and local SEO targeting cosmetic keywords are practical steps. Conversely, if you see more patients needing restorative work or full-mouth reconstructions, invest in educational content and targeted outreach for implants.

    Additionally, consider your marketing budget and the complexity of your sales funnel. Invisalign marketing often demands visually appealing ads and frequent content updates, whereas implant marketing benefits from in-depth case presentations and patient education strategies.

    Final Thoughts

    Both Invisalign and implant marketing strategies serve distinct niches and patient needs. A tailored approach that combines visual appeal with educational depth ensures more practical results and better ROI. Focus on what your practice excels at, and align your marketing efforts accordingly for sustainable growth.

    Exploring Alternatives to Traditional Amazon Seller Agencies

    For Amazon sellers looking to optimize their operations without relying solely on conventional agencies, there are several viable options. Whether you’re a seasoned seller or just starting, understanding these alternatives can help you scale smarter and maintain more control over your business. To dive deeper into this topic, check out What are alternatives to traditional Amazon seller agencies?.

    1. In-House Management

    Best for:

    • Sellers with moderate experience
    • Those who prefer full control over their listings
    • Budget-conscious entrepreneurs

    Key Specs:

    • Avoids agency fees
    • Leverage existing team or hire part-time specialists (e.g., virtual assistants, freelance PPC managers)
    • Requires familiarity with Amazon tools and policies

    Tradeoffs:

    • Time-consuming to learn and manage
    • Limited scalability without dedicated staff
    • Risk of trial-and-error impacting performance

    How to Choose:

    Ideal if you have the bandwidth to learn Amazon’s platform and manage your listings. Focus on tutorials, community forums, and small-scale testing before scaling.

    2. Freelance Platforms and Consultants

    Best for:

    • Brands seeking specialized expertise
    • Small to medium sellers needing flexible support
    • Cost-effective alternative to agencies

    Key Specs:

    • Platforms like Upwork, Fiverr, or Freelancer
    • Hire consultants with proven Amazon experience
    • Project-based or retainer agreements

    Tradeoffs:

    • Varying quality; requires vetting
    • Less comprehensive than full-service agencies
    • Potential communication gaps

    How to Choose:

    Look for freelancers with proven Amazon track records, clear portfolios, and good reviews. Clearly define scope and expectations upfront.

    3. Automation Tools and Software Platforms

    Best for:

    • Sellers comfortable with self-management
    • Those seeking to scale efficiently
    • Anyone wanting to reduce manual workload

    Key Specs:

    • Tools like Helium 10, Jungle Scout, or Sellics
    • Automation for keywords, PPC campaigns, inventory management
    • Subscription-based pricing

    Tradeoffs:

    • Requires initial setup and learning curve
    • Limited decision-making capability—software supports but doesn’t replace strategy
    • Cost adds up over time

    How to Choose:

    Select platforms aligning with your selling volume and specific needs. Combine multiple tools if necessary, but avoid overlapping functions.

    4. Training Courses and Community Groups

    Best for:

    • Entrepreneurs eager to learn the ropes
    • Sellers wanting to DIY but with expert guidance
    • Those who value ongoing education and peer support

    Key Specs:

    • Paid courses from Amazon experts
    • Online communities like Facebook groups or Reddit forums
    • Webinars, workshops, and coaching programs

    Tradeoffs:

    • Time investment required
    • Learning curve can slow immediate growth
    • No direct management—self-led implementation

    How to Choose:

    Identify reputable instructors and active communities. Use these resources as a supplement to your efforts, not the sole strategy.

    5. Hybrid Approach: Combining Strategies

    Best for:

    • Sellers wanting flexibility and control
    • Businesses scaling beyond solo effort
    • Those seeking a balanced, risk-mitigated approach

    Key Specs:

    • Combine in-house management, freelancers, and automation tools
    • Adjust resource allocation based on growth stage
    • Leverage educational resources for continual improvement

    Tradeoffs:

    • Coordination complexity
    • Potential overlapping responsibilities
    • Requires strategic planning

    How to Choose:

    Start small, identify your core needs, and layer in additional resources as your business scales. Regular review ensures you optimize each component.

    Conclusion

    There’s no one-size-fits-all answer when it comes to alternatives to traditional Amazon seller agencies. Your choice depends on your budget, expertise, and growth goals. Whether managing in-house, hiring freelancers, leveraging automation, or investing in education, each approach offers practical benefits aligned with real-world loadout scenarios. By selecting the right strategy, you can stay agile, cost-effective, and in control of your Amazon business’s future.
